About the role We're looking for a Legal Counsel to join Southern Cross supporting both the Remediation and Legal teams — a broad, substantive role that spans remediation and legal advisory, giving you real variety across two distinct but connected areas of work. This is a fixed-term opportunity (18 months). Why join us This is a role with genuine breadth. On any given week you might be advising on a complex remediation investigation, working through the legal dimensions of a dispute, or providing legal support on marketing campaigns. You'll work directly with business teams, bringing practical, commercially informed advice that helps Southern Cross make sound decisions and deliver good outcomes for our members. You'll also work across both our Remediation and Legal functions, applying your legal expertise in different contexts and building a strong understanding of how a regulated health insurer operates. This is a role for someone who enjoys variety, works well in a collaborative team, and wants their legal work to have real-world impact. About the opportunity As Legal Counsel, you'll operate across both the Remediation team and Legal team. In your remediation work, you'll provide risk-based legal advice to support investigations into potential customer harm - advising on the application of relevant legislation, regulatory guidance, and case law, and supporting the identification and assessment of legal risk. You'll work closely with remediation specialists and data analysts to ensure investigations are well-grounded and outcomes are fair. In your legal advisory work, you'll manage and advise on investigations, complaints, and dispute resolution, and partner with business across marketing and communications, product and our commercial contracting teams. You'll help the business understand its legal and regulatory obligations, shape pragmatic solutions, and contribute to building legal capability more broadly through knowledge-sharing and training. This role suits someone who is comfortable navigating ambiguity, translating complex legal issues into plain language, and working autonomously while remaining well-connected to the wider team. What you'll do Remediation focus Provide timely, pragmatic legal advice to support remediation investigations, planning, and execution Advise on the interpretation and application of relevant legislation, regulatory guidance, and case law as it applies to remediation activity Support the identification, articulation, and assessment of customer harm and legal risk Identify and escalate material legal risks, providing clear options and recommendations Support consistent application of remediation policy and guidance Legal focus Manage and advise on investigations, complaints, and dispute resolution matters Partner with business units to provide timely, practical legal advice across marketing and communications, product interpretation and commercial contracting. Advise on legal and regulatory obligations, helping the business understand risks, options, and implications Shape solutions that balance legal risk, strategic objectives, commercial opportunity, and member interests What you'll bring An LLB or equivalent, with a current New Zealand practising certificate At least 5 years' PQE, ideally with some in-house experience A solid understanding of the New Zealand financial services regulatory environment and regulator expectations Strong risk management capability, including handling sensitive data and customer outcomes Strong analytical, problem-solving, and communication skills — able to translate complex legal matters into plain language Experience in dispute resolution or litigation Demonstrated ability to build trusted relationships and collaborate across teams A practical, solutions-focused approach that balances legal risk with commercial and strategic objectives Who we are Ngākau nui.
